About Shatner Turnabout Crescent

Shatner Turnabout Crescent is a residential area in Vaughan, Ontario, known for its family-friendly atmosphere and proximity to various amenities. The neighborhood features a mix of modern and traditional homes, with easy access to schools, parks, shopping centers, and cultural attractions.

Features

Proximity to Major Highways - Convenient access to Highway 400 and Highway 7 for easy commuting.
Family-Oriented Community - A safe and welcoming environment with parks and schools nearby.

Schools

St. Gregory the Great Catholic School - A highly-rated Catholic elementary school offering quality education.
Maple High School - A public secondary school known for its strong academic and extracurricular programs.

Malls

Vaughan Mills - A large shopping mall featuring over 200 stores, entertainment options, and dining.
Promenade Mall - A mid-sized shopping center with retail stores, a cinema, and restaurants.

Parks

North Maple Regional Park - A spacious park with walking trails, sports fields, and picnic areas.
Maple Community Centre & Park - A local park with playgrounds, a splash pad, and recreational facilities.

Museums & Theaters

McMichael Canadian Art Collection - A renowned art gallery showcasing Canadian and Indigenous artworks.
Cineplex Cinemas Vaughan - A modern movie theater with multiple screens and VIP seating options.

Local Landmarks

Canada's Wonderland - A major amusement park with roller coasters, water rides, and seasonal events.
Kortright Centre for Conservation - A nature reserve offering hiking trails, educational programs, and wildlife viewing.
